Erdogan calls Mitsotakis to strengthen ties

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dogan called Greek Prime Minister Kyriakos Mitsotakis.

Axar.az reports that the leaders stressed their determination to work together to further develop cooperation between Turkiye and Greece based on good-neighborly, friendly, and allied relations.

During the phone call, Erdogan congratulated the Greek Prime Minister on his birthday.
